引言
交互媒体设计是现代设计中一个充满活力的领域,它融合了技术、艺术和用户心理学。通过本篇文章,我们将深入探讨交互媒体设计的核心概念,通过分析经典案例来提取宝贵的启示,帮助读者更好地理解和应用这一设计理念。
交互媒体设计的核心概念
1. 用户中心设计
交互媒体设计的核心理念是以用户为中心。这意味着设计师需要深入了解目标用户的需求、行为和偏好,从而创造出让用户感到愉悦和高效的交互体验。
2. 用户体验(UX)
用户体验是交互媒体设计的重要组成部分,它关注用户在使用产品或服务过程中的感受和满意度。一个优秀的交互媒体设计应该能够提供直观、流畅和愉悦的用户体验。
3. 可用性
可用性是指产品或服务在满足用户需求的同时,用户能够轻松、快速地完成任务的难易程度。交互媒体设计中的可用性设计旨在减少用户的认知负担,提高操作效率。
经典案例分析
1. Airbnb
Airbnb的交互设计成功之处在于其简洁直观的用户界面和强大的搜索功能。用户可以通过地理位置、价格、房间类型等多种条件快速找到合适的住宿。以下是其设计特点的代码示例:
<div id="search-form">
<input type="text" id="location" placeholder="输入目的地">
<input type="number" id="price" placeholder="价格范围">
<select id="room-type">
<option value="entire-place">整套房源</option>
<option value="private-room">独立房间</option>
<option value="shared-room">共享房间</option>
</select>
<button type="submit">搜索</button>
</div>
2. Slack
Slack的交互设计注重团队协作的流畅性。其聊天界面简洁明了,用户可以轻松地发送消息、共享文件和进行视频通话。以下是其聊天界面的代码示例:
<div class="chat-container">
<div class="chat-message">
<div class="message-author">用户A</div>
<div class="message-content">你好,有什么可以帮助你的吗?</div>
</div>
<div class="chat-message">
<div class="message-author">用户B</div>
<div class="message-content">我想上传一些文件。</div>
</div>
<div class="chat-input">
<input type="text" placeholder="输入消息">
<button type="button">发送</button>
</div>
</div>
3. Duolingo
Duolingo的交互设计专注于语言学习的趣味性和互动性。其游戏化的学习方式吸引了大量用户,以下是其学习界面的代码示例:
<div class="language-learning">
<div class="exercise">
<div class="question">What is your name?</div>
<input type="text" id="answer">
<button type="button" onclick="checkAnswer()">提交</button>
</div>
<div class="feedback">正确!</div>
</div>
启示与总结
通过以上经典案例分析,我们可以得出以下启示:
- 用户需求至上:交互媒体设计应始终关注用户的需求,确保设计符合用户的实际使用场景。
- 简洁明了:简洁的用户界面可以提高可用性,让用户能够快速找到所需功能。
- 创新与实用相结合:在满足用户需求的基础上,尝试创新的设计元素,提升用户体验。
- 持续优化:交互媒体设计是一个不断迭代的过程,设计师需要根据用户反馈和市场变化不断优化产品。
总之,交互媒体设计是一门融合多学科知识的综合性设计领域。通过深入了解用户需求、掌握核心概念并借鉴经典案例,我们可以创造出更多优秀的设计作品。
